She would have turned 12 years old on Friday, but a little girl died Wednesday evening, hours after she was shot in the back by a bullet intended for someone else.

Thursday, Akron Police visited several specific locations checking on possible leads. The Northern Ohio Fugitive Task Force is now offering $5,000 to anyone who turns the thugs in.

“She said mommy mommy and turned around and there was a big bump on her back,” said the victim’s sister, Natasha Taylor. 

Carmella Holley was watching television in a second floor apartment of the Hillwood Homes in the 1100 block of Key Place when gunfire erupted outside in the parking lot. 

Akron Police say the 11-year old was hit by a stray bullet when at least five bullets hit the apartment building around 4:20PM.

“Next thing you know, everybody was running and Carmella was saying, “my back, my back,” said the victim’s sister, Natasha Taylor. “We was just sitting there watching TV and eating candy, and somebody shot her.”

Carmella was rushed to Akron Children’s Hospital by EMS in serious and then critical condition. She later died.

The suspects are on the loose.
